Netherlands Inductive and Linear Variable Differential Transformer (Lvdt) Sensors Market Top 5 Importing Countries and Market Competition (HHI) Analysis

The Netherlands experienced a significant increase in inductive and linear variable differential transformer (LVDT) sensors import shipments in 2024, with top exporting countries being Germany, Finland, Estonia, USA, and Japan. Despite the strong growth rates with a CAGR of 16.98% between 2020-24 and a remarkable growth rate of 42.17% from 2023-24, the market concentration, as measured by HHI, remained low. This suggests a diverse and competitive market landscape, indicating opportunities for further expansion and innovation in the LVDT sensor industry in the Netherlands.
